Union Bank plans to launch 30 new branches in Karnataka

Mangalore Today News Network

Mangalore, May 1, 2012: Mumbai based Union Bank of India will open 59 ATMs and 30 branches in Karnataka this financial year, informed the Chairman and MD of Union Bank of India D. Sarkar, addressing a press meet held after the inauguration of the bank’s third regional office in Mangalore on Monday, April 30, 2012.

Further, he said that the bank would be launching its branches in Hassan, Mysore, Udupi, Chikmagalur, Bellary, and Shimoga as well as Gurupur, Mangalore, Kundapur, and Manipal.

The other two ROs being based in Belgaum and Bangalore, the Mangalore RO will cover 11 districts comprising 29 branches and handling business worth Rs. 991 crore. He also said that 10 more branches will be launched in these districts, each including three financial inclusion branches supervising 20 business correspondents and act as customer grievance redress points.

Today, Union Bank of India has 143 branches and 198 ATMs and its total business in the state is worth Rs. 12,543 crore. The bank is now catering to the banking needs of 54 villages and plans to cover 62 more villages the current year.
